We have opportunities in your area to be a Tutor, working with children and young people with Special Educational Needs. Working across a broad age range, some students may be disengaged with mainstream education or education in a classroom / school setting for a number of reasons. This could be due to Autism, ADHD and sometimes challenging behaviour. We support disadvantaged students achieve their academic goals and are a leading reputable provider of alternative and supplementary education to schools and local authorities, supporting children from all backgrounds through one-to-one and small group tuition programmes.

Hours are flexible to suit you and whilst experience is preferred, a formal teaching qualification is not necessarily required. We are unable to offer sponsorship, and UK based education experience is required.
- Create lesson plans and deliver tuition programmes that are designed to engage, inspire and teach.
- Report on attendance, attainment and engagement for all tutoring sessions.
- Complete training as required and commit to safeguarding principles.

What we offer
- Competitive weekly pay through PAYE.
- Control over your workload; flexible roles that fit around your existing commitments and availability.
- Access to ongoing training opportunities including safeguarding, online tutoring and CPD.
- A team of co-ordinators who will work closely with you to find the right roles for you, and who provide ongoing support for each assignment.

**Requirements**:

- Minimum 6 months education based work experience gained in the UK
- Must live and be eligible to work in the UK.
- Be willing to undertake a full Disclosure and Barring Service (DBS) check and referencing process, as well as subscribing to the DBS Update Service.
- A commitment to safeguarding.
